Lines Matching +full:0 +full:x8000f000

78     address_space_read(&address_space_memory, 0x90000071,  in rtc_read()
86 uint8_t buf = val & 0xff; in rtc_write()
87 address_space_write(&address_space_memory, 0x90000071, in rtc_write()
104 return 0xff; in dma_dummy_read()
144 sysbus_mmio_map(sysbus, 0, 0x80001000); in mips_jazz_init_net()
145 sysbus_connect_irq(sysbus, 0, qdev_get_gpio_in(rc4030, 4)); in mips_jazz_init_net()
149 checksum = 0; in mips_jazz_init_net()
150 for (i = 0; i < 6; i++) { in mips_jazz_init_net()
153 if (checksum > 0xff) { in mips_jazz_init_net()
154 checksum = (checksum + 1) & 0xff; in mips_jazz_init_net()
157 prom[7] = 0xff - checksum; in mips_jazz_init_net()
162 #define MAGNUM_BIOS_SIZE_MAX 0x7e000
166 #define SONIC_PROM_SIZE 0x1000
221 * Chipset returns 0 in invalid reads and do not raise data exceptions. in mips_jazz_init()
238 memory_region_add_subregion(address_space, 0, machine->ram); in mips_jazz_init()
243 0, MAGNUM_BIOS_SIZE); in mips_jazz_init()
244 memory_region_add_subregion(address_space, 0x1fc00000LL, bios); in mips_jazz_init()
245 memory_region_add_subregion(address_space, 0xfff00000LL, bios2); in mips_jazz_init()
250 bios_size = load_image_targphys(filename, 0xfff00000LL, in mips_jazz_init()
256 if ((bios_size < 0 || bios_size > MAGNUM_BIOS_SIZE) in mips_jazz_init()
269 sysbus_connect_irq(sysbus, 0, env->irq[6]); in mips_jazz_init()
271 memory_region_add_subregion(address_space, 0x80000000, in mips_jazz_init()
272 sysbus_mmio_get_region(sysbus, 0)); in mips_jazz_init()
273 memory_region_add_subregion(address_space, 0xf0000000, in mips_jazz_init()
276 NULL, "dummy_dma", 0x1000); in mips_jazz_init()
277 memory_region_add_subregion(address_space, 0x8000d000, dma_dummy); in mips_jazz_init()
281 memory_region_add_subregion(address_space, 0x8000b000, dp8393x_prom); in mips_jazz_init()
283 /* ISA bus: IO space at 0x90000000, mem space at 0x91000000 */ in mips_jazz_init()
284 memory_region_init(isa_io, NULL, "isa-io", 0x00010000); in mips_jazz_init()
285 memory_region_init(isa_mem, NULL, "isa-mem", 0x01000000); in mips_jazz_init()
286 memory_region_add_subregion(address_space, 0x90000000, isa_io); in mips_jazz_init()
287 memory_region_add_subregion(address_space, 0x91000000, isa_mem); in mips_jazz_init()
293 i8257_dma_init(OBJECT(rc4030), isa_bus, 0); in mips_jazz_init()
294 pit = i8254_pit_init(isa_bus, 0x40, 0, NULL); in mips_jazz_init()
305 sysbus_mmio_map(sysbus, 0, 0x60080000); in mips_jazz_init()
306 sysbus_mmio_map(sysbus, 1, 0x40000000); in mips_jazz_init()
307 sysbus_connect_irq(sysbus, 0, qdev_get_gpio_in(rc4030, 3)); in mips_jazz_init()
311 memory_region_init_rom(rom_mr, NULL, "g364fb.rom", 0x80000, in mips_jazz_init()
314 memory_region_add_subregion(address_space, 0x60000000, rom_mr); in mips_jazz_init()
315 rom[0] = 0x10; /* Mips G364 */ in mips_jazz_init()
320 qdev_prop_set_uint8(dev, "it_shift", 0); in mips_jazz_init()
323 sysbus_mmio_map(sysbus, 0, 0x60000000); in mips_jazz_init()
324 sysbus_mmio_map(sysbus, 1, 0x400a0000); in mips_jazz_init()
340 esp->dma_opaque = dmas[0]; in mips_jazz_init()
341 sysbus_esp->it_shift = 0; in mips_jazz_init()
347 sysbus_connect_irq(sysbus, 0, qdev_get_gpio_in(rc4030, 5)); in mips_jazz_init()
348 sysbus_mmio_map(sysbus, 0, 0x80002000); in mips_jazz_init()
353 for (n = 0; n < MAX_FD; n++) { in mips_jazz_init()
354 fds[n] = drive_get(IF_FLOPPY, 0, n); in mips_jazz_init()
357 fdctrl_init_sysbus(qdev_get_gpio_in(rc4030, 1), 0x80003000, fds); in mips_jazz_init()
361 memory_region_init_io(rtc, NULL, &rtc_ops, NULL, "rtc", 0x1000); in mips_jazz_init()
362 memory_region_add_subregion(address_space, 0x80004000, rtc); in mips_jazz_init()
367 qdev_prop_set_uint32(DEVICE(i8042), "size", 0x1000); in mips_jazz_init()
375 memory_region_add_subregion(address_space, 0x80005000, in mips_jazz_init()
377 0)); in mips_jazz_init()
380 serial_mm_init(address_space, 0x80006000, 0, in mips_jazz_init()
382 serial_hd(0), DEVICE_NATIVE_ENDIAN); in mips_jazz_init()
383 serial_mm_init(address_space, 0x80007000, 0, in mips_jazz_init()
388 if (parallel_hds[0]) in mips_jazz_init()
389 parallel_mm_init(address_space, 0x80008000, 0, in mips_jazz_init()
390 qdev_get_gpio_in(rc4030, 0), parallel_hds[0]); in mips_jazz_init()
392 /* FIXME: missing Jazz sound at 0x8000c000, rc4030[2] */ in mips_jazz_init()
398 sysbus_mmio_map(sysbus, 0, 0x80009000); in mips_jazz_init()
401 sysbus_create_simple("jazz-led", 0x8000f000, NULL); in mips_jazz_init()